Transaction 31669f7392fb62100e32aff576fb77a41b687002b7b921ffd4579deb665e92a3
1 Input
1 Output
-
31669f7392fb62100e32aff576fb77a41b687002b7b921ffd4579deb665e92a3:0
- value
- 1602991
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38bc7b11eb57ea9303811b25cd5022626d87ebfe OP_EQUALVERIFY OP_CHECKSIG
- address
- 16AzdccghLgnLTXZogQkNsquUUN4ZEEa6i